DEDRICK FERGUSON Petitioner(s) v. STATE OF FLORIDA Respondent(s)


Because petitioner has failed to show a clear legal right to the relief requested, he is not entitled to mandamus relief. Accordingly, the petition for writ of mandamus is hereby denied. See Huffman v. State, 813 So. 2d 10, 11 (Fla. 2000). LEWIS, QUINCE, CANADY, LABARGA, and PERRY, JJ., concur. A True Copy
